Corona's Band
| I have been seeing a lot of Corona and band this winter. His band is doing great....this is one of the largest bands on the range. |
| Most of us agree Cheyenne is his lead mare. I am not sure, but I think she might be pregnant. She has not had a foal since 2009 (Tripod). |
| Isn't she beautiful? |
| That is the little palo filly we call Can Wakan. She is trying to get a sniff of me. |
| This is the other two year old filly, Maybell. She is a full sister to Can Wakan. |
| The grey mare, Indian Rose, is shy and hard to photograph. It is her and the sorrel mare that have the foals. The black (Em) and Cheyenne are not so prolific. |
| Indian Rose's youngsters (Yampatika and Indiana Jones)....She also has a two year old colt that runs with the bachelors (Craig), but he has not been seen for a very long time. |
| Corona is a loving father. |

Corona's Band
| Finally! It hs been a long time since I have seen Corona's band, but today they are right off the road. Everyone is there since the last time I obseved them, which was last June. |
| Corona looks fabulous. He is in his prime and I consider him "the King of Sand Wash Basin". He takes my breath away! |
| He seems proud of his 20011 foals, Indiana Jones and Can Wakan. They are just perfect in every way. They love to play together. Indiana is a colt and Can Wakan is a filly. Can Wakan was born first. |
| So cute! |
| They are both happy, playful mustangs. |
| The grey mare, Indian Rose, is Indiana's mom and she also has her yearling filly, Yampatika, by her side. |
| It is hard to mistake Cheyenne, Corona's lead mare. She is the only pinto/palomino on the range. No foal for her this year, nor last year. Not every mare is prolific. |
| Cheyene from the side. |
| Maybell, one of the many 2 year old fillies who is still with their families. There is another 2 year old filly in this band, the bay, One Spirit. |
| Corona on the run... |
| He meets up with Rounder. They exchange a few postures, and Corona proves he is dominant. |
| After Corona confronts the other stallion he snakes his band and runs them in a great big circle. It was a sight to behold. |
| To see wild mustangs running free as they were meant is an honor. |
| I am amazed how healthy and fit these wild horses are. They can really run! This was a fun encounter, one I will not forget. |
